Govt condemns kidnapping of SA boy in Malaysia

Sunday, April 29, 2012

Pretoria- Government has condemned the kidnapping of a 12-year-old South African boy in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ia.

Nayati Shamilin Moodliar was on his way to school when he was kidnapped on the morning of April 27.

"The South African government condemns in the strongest possible terms this act of criminality and calls on the government of Malaysia to continue with its efforts to secure the release of Nayati Moodliar and to bring the perpetrators to book," the Department of International Relations and Cooperation said in a statement.

It said government has been in contact with the family both in Malaysia and South Africa since the incident took place.

"The South African High Commissioner in Malaysia has visited the family to express government's support to them. The High Commission is in daily contact with the relevant authorities," it added.

It also called on the public to support the Moodliar family until they are reunited with their son.
